The Importance of Clock Spring Cable Integrity



The spiral cable line’s integrity is critically important for safe function of the SRS release system. A worn steering wheel coil spring can cause unexpected airbag activation, which is hazardous to auto users. Conversely, a failed steering wheel coil spring might inhibit the SRS from releasing in a crash, leaving passengers exposed to severe damage. Regular assessment and change of the clock spring are therefore highly recommended to preserve peak security and reduce the possible for failure.

Clock Spring Spiral Cable Materials and Manufacturing



The key fabrication of clock spring coiled cables relies heavily on unique material choice and precise production methods. Traditionally, phosphor bronze is the favored alloy due to its excellent pliability and erosion immunity. However, other options, such as nic alloys or even certain stainless steels, are employed depending on the purpose requirements. Creation typically involves a complicated coiling method, often executed on high-speed automated devices. The strain and width of the final cable are carefully controlled to make certain consistent operation and durability. Furthermore, surface treatments, like stannous plating, may be given to enhance conductivity and protect against outside conditions.
